I've been using this machine fairly regularly for the past three years and it's been great. My auto dial has not broken and it's still functioning normally. In fact, I have never used the manual timer, I just set it to the hardness I want and let the machine do the rest. A particular hit with my friends is Nutella gelato. They all ask me how I get the great consistency.
One issue I have had is when I try to churn a new ice cream base directly (or even up to an hour or so) after the previous one. The machine seems to get confused and will kee...Read more
p on churning the second one indefinitely until you manually turn it off. It seems to need at least two hours or so to completely return to room temperature and somehow reset itself. Other than that, I love this machine and would definitely recommend it for serious ice cream makers/lovers.1 comment

I have used the Breville Smart Scoop BC 1600 for about 12 months but have stopped now because I cannot find a spare part that is needed for the operation of the Smart Scoop. Its my fault for replacing the bowl on the spindle in a clumsy manner, I or one of us in the family has damaged the seal or neoprene cast 'o' ring which seals the shaft from the bucket at the base of the shaft its not circular in x section but wedge shaped in x section.
When I ring to buy the part no one knows what I am talking about.

This machine was awesome until 2 days after the warranty ran out, the dial broke and a weird unpleasant smell is now emitted from the machine when used in manual mode. Called customer service and was just advised of a local service centre to send it back for repairs which I will have to pay for and a blunt explanation of that warranty is only valid within the 2 year time period and even a day or two out of it no longer covers the machine. A few months out of warranty fair enough, but two days??? Breville you could at least make an exception

This was going to be the third season for this machine. Last year it started to make a lot of noise while churning. Now it just does not turn at all. We called Breville. They are asking for $150 including shipping. Not too bad, but not cheap either. Why should we spend more than the original $450? This was supposed to be the top of the line machine. Unfortunately it seems that this one, as we ll as most machines these days, they are made to last only a couple of years. Then "throw it away" and get another one.

We purchased this machine 3 months ago and have used it regularly from day 1!! My main reason for purchasing this machine over cheaper models was due to not having to pre-freeze the bowl 12hrs prior to making the ice cream.
It's easy to use and the results have been consistent every time.
In the recipe book included there are a lot of recipes that call for eggs but I have found many recipes online that don't use eggs and turn out beautifully!!

I bought mine online for $21.00, so at that price you can hardly complain, It probably does the same job as much more expensive ice cream churns, but it's noisy. I should point out to prospective buyers that this is an ice cream churn, which is different to to a real ice cream maker, but real ice cream makers have a compressor like a fridge, are big and heavy and will cost you hundreds of dollars.
